Comparison of Different Natural Fiber Reinforced Concrete: Review
Journal Title: International Journal of Engineering Sciences & Research Technology - Year 30, Vol 3, Issue 2
Abstract
In recent years, a great deal of interest in concrete leads to the most frequently used construction material in the world. The fiber reinforcement can effectively improve the toughness, shrinkage and durability characteristics of concrete. Out of commonly used fibers, easily available low cost natural fibers can be used. In spite of many of the researchers of using different natural fibers to improve the different properties of light weight concrete still required a lot of research as well as investigations. The present work consists of the comparison of different natural fibers. The slump, compressive strength as well as flexural strength were compared for these natural fibers. It was observed that oil palm trunk fibers shown very good results not only for compressive strength but also for flexural strength. This work is only an accumulation of information about GFRC and the research work which is already carried out by other researchers.
